How To Fix OIUP036 - You do not have the required authorization to schedule this job.


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: OIUP - PDM Message Class

  • Message number: 036

  • Message text: You do not have the required authorization to schedule this job.

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    The system determined you do not have the required authorization to
    perform the data move.

    System Response

    This is an error.

    How to fix this error?

    If you believe you need this authorization, you need to add the follwing
    authorization object to your profile:
    O_OIUP_JOB
    ,,- CLIENT = required client(s) in which to perform the operation
    ,,- ACTVT = '16'

    Procedure for System Administrators

    The system administrator needs to add the above object into your
    profile.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message OIUP036 - You do not have the required authorization to schedule this job. ?

    The SAP error message OIUP036, which states "You do not have the required authorization to schedule this job," typically indicates that the user attempting to schedule a job does not have the necessary authorizations or permissions to perform that action in the SAP system.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Authorizations: The user lacks the required roles or authorizations in their user profile to schedule jobs.
    2. Job Scheduling Restrictions: There may be specific restrictions set up in the system that prevent certain users from scheduling jobs.
    3. Role Configuration: The roles assigned to the user may not include the necessary transaction codes or authorization objects related to job scheduling.

    Solution:

    1. Check User Roles: Verify the roles assigned to the user. This can be done by navigating to transaction code SU01 (User Maintenance) and checking the user’s profile.
    2. Review Authorizations: Use transaction code SU53 immediately after the error occurs to see which authorization check failed. This will provide insight into what specific authorization is missing.
    3. Modify Roles: If the user lacks the necessary authorizations, a security administrator or someone with the appropriate permissions should modify the user’s roles or create a new role that includes the necessary authorizations for job scheduling.
    4. Authorization Objects: Ensure that the relevant authorization objects (such as S_BTCH_JOB, S_BTCH_ADM, etc.) are included in the user’s roles. These objects control access to batch job scheduling.
    5.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or your organization’s internal guidelines for job scheduling to ensure compliance with any specific requirements or restrictions.
